Oilseeds Market size was valued at USD 257.67 Billion in 2024 and is poised to grow from USD 267.98 Billion in 2025 to USD 366.74 Billion by 2033, growing at a CAGR of 4% during the forecast period (2026-2033).
The global oilseeds market is experiencing robust growth driven by rising demand as the population expands. However, the sector has encountered challenges due to supply disruptions linked to climate change in key producing regions, resulting in fluctuating prices. A primary catalyst for this growth is the surging demand for vegetable oil, particularly from the biodiesel sector, which seeks alternatives to traditional fuels. Emerging economies, including China, Brazil, India, Malaysia, and Indonesia, are projected to account for a significant portion of this market expansion. Soybeans currently dominate production and are expected to grow the fastest, followed by rapeseed, cottonseed, groundnuts, sunflower, palm kernels, and copra, driven by their essential role in accommodating the needs of an increasing global population.

Driver of the Oilseeds Market
A key factor influencing the global oilseeds market is the rising demand for vegetable oil, particularly from the biodiesel sector. As societies pivot towards renewable energy solutions and aim to reduce dependence on traditional fossil fuels, the biodiesel industry has experienced notable growth. This shift has significantly increased the need for vegetable oil, which is primarily sourced from oilseeds. Consequently, the expansion of the biodiesel market serves as a critical catalyst for the overall growth and utilization of oilseeds on a global scale, highlighting the interconnected relationship between energy sustainability and agricultural production.
Restraints in the Oilseeds Market
A significant challenge faced by the global oilseeds market is the instability in supply stemming from fluctuating climate conditions. Regions that are prominent in oilseed production frequently encounter severe weather events, including droughts, floods, and extreme temperature shifts, which can lead to considerable supply shortages and interruptions. These environmental factors create imbalances between supply and demand, resulting in price volatility and threatening overall market stability. To ensure sustainable growth within the oilseeds market, it is essential to effectively manage and mitigate the risks associated with climate change and its detrimental effects on oilseed production.
Market Trends of the Oilseeds Market
The global oilseeds market is witnessing a notable trend towards sustainable sourcing practices, driven by heightened consumer awareness regarding environmental and social impacts. Stakeholders increasingly demand oilseeds that are responsibly sourced and traceable, prompting market players to embrace sustainable farming techniques. This shift includes a commitment to promoting biodiversity, minimizing pesticide use, and upholding fair labor standards throughout the supply chain. As a result, the industry is aligning itself with consumers' expectations for ethically produced and environmentally friendly oilseed products. This trend underscores a broader commitment to environmental stewardship and responsible agricultural practices that will shape the future of the oilseeds market.
